- [ ] Orphaned-resource sweeper (Tidewatch): confirm dry-run output against staging before enabling delete mode. Verify the sweeper honors the 48-hour grace window, skips anything tagged retain=true, and logs every candidate with its owning project. Reviewer should double-check the exclusion list covers the Marlow snapshot buckets. Sign-off requires the sweeper run to match the build recorded below.

trace token, fafog-kageg: htk4_98e6

Before each release, sanity-check the driver-assignment heuristic in Routefox. It weights proximity, shift time remaining, and vehicle capacity — if any weight config changed this cycle, run the replay harness against last Tuesday's order set and eyeball the assignment diff. Anything over 5% churn needs a sign-off from dispatch ops. The replay steps and thresholds live on the internal release page.

wiki page, hahif-hahif: https://argocd.kelvisys.corp/browse/board/settings/pages/1442e0b1065d83f1

## Authentication

The Grubelsweep service scans Tarnview environments nightly for orphaned volumes, stale snapshots, and unattached load balancers. It authenticates to the internal inventory API with a service-scoped key; it cannot delete anything tagged keep=true. New team members: never run the sweeper with personal credentials, since deletions are attributed to the key owner. The staging key is rotated monthly by the platform rota. For local testing, use the key that appears directly below.

gateway credential: kto23_LX9A4ys6i4nzHtpOLNLodKK